    41 // Initialization done by VM thread in vm_init_globals()
    42 void check_ThreadShadow();
    43 void eventlog_init();
    44 void mutex_init();
    45 void chunkpool_init();
    46 void perfMemory_init();
    48 // Initialization done by Java thread in init_globals()
    49 void management_init();
    50 void bytecodes_init();
    51 void classLoader_init();
    52 void codeCache_init();
    53 void VM_Version_init();
    54 void os_init_globals();        // depends on VM_Version_init, before universe_init
    55 void stubRoutines_init1();
    56 jint universe_init();          // depends on codeCache_init and stubRoutines_init
    57 void interpreter_init();       // before any methods loaded
    58 void invocationCounter_init(); // before any methods loaded
    59 void marksweep_init();
    60 void accessFlags_init();
    61 void templateTable_init();
    62 void InterfaceSupport_init();
    63 void universe2_init();  // dependent on codeCache_init and stubRoutines_init, loads primordial classes
    64 void referenceProcessor_init();
    65 void jni_handles_init();
    66 void vmStructs_init();
    68 void vtableStubs_init();
    69 void InlineCacheBuffer_init();
    70 void compilerOracle_init();
    71 void compilationPolicy_init();
    72 void compileBroker_init();
    74 // Initialization after compiler initialization
    75 bool universe_post_init();  // must happen after compiler_init
    76 void javaClasses_init();  // must happen after vtable initialization
    77 void stubRoutines_init2(); // note: StubRoutines need 2-phase init
    79 // Do not disable thread-local-storage, as it is important for some
    80 // JNI/JVM/JVMTI functions and signal handlers to work properly
    81 // during VM shutdown
    82 void perfMemory_exit();
    83 void ostream_exit();
    85 void vm_init_globals() {
    86   check_ThreadShadow();
    87   basic_types_init();
    88   eventlog_init();
    89   mutex_init();
    90   chunkpool_init();
    91   perfMemory_init();
    92 }
    95 jint init_globals() {
    96   HandleMark hm;
    97   management_init();
    98   bytecodes_init();
    99   classLoader_init();
   100   codeCache_init();
   101   VM_Version_init();
   102   os_init_globals();
   103   stubRoutines_init1();
   104   jint status = universe_init();  // dependent on codeCache_init and
   105                                   // stubRoutines_init1 and metaspace_init.
   106   if (status != JNI_OK)
   107     return status;
   109   interpreter_init();  // before any methods loaded
   110   invocationCounter_init();  // before any methods loaded
   111   marksweep_init();
   112   accessFlags_init();
   113   templateTable_init();
   114   InterfaceSupport_init();
   115   SharedRuntime::generate_stubs();
   116   universe2_init();  // dependent on codeCache_init and stubRoutines_init1
   117   referenceProcessor_init();
   118   jni_handles_init();
   119 #if INCLUDE_VM_STRUCTS
   120   vmStructs_init();
   121 #endif // INCLUDE_VM_STRUCTS
   123   vtableStubs_init();
   124   InlineCacheBuffer_init();
   125   compilerOracle_init();
   126   compilationPolicy_init();
   127   compileBroker_init();
   128   VMRegImpl::set_regName();
   130   if (!universe_post_init()) {
   131     return JNI_ERR;
   132   }
   133   javaClasses_init();   // must happen after vtable initialization
   134   stubRoutines_init2(); // note: StubRoutines need 2-phase init
   136 #if INCLUDE_NMT
   137   // Solaris stack is walkable only after stubRoutines are set up.
   138   // On Other platforms, the stack is always walkable.
   139   NMT_stack_walkable = true;
   140 #endif // INCLUDE_NMT
   142   // All the flags that get adjusted by VM_Version_init and os::init_2
   143   // have been set so dump the flags now.
   144   if (PrintFlagsFinal) {
   145     CommandLineFlags::printFlags(tty, false);
   146   }
   148   return JNI_OK;
   149 }
